Jaylon Smith is a Free Agent American football linebacker who played for the Dallas Cowboys. He played college football at Notre Dame and was drafted 34th overall by the Cowboys in the second round of the 2016 NFL Draft.

Contract:

From 2018 to Week 4 of this season, Smith played in all 68 games for the Cowboys with 56 starts, totaling 516 tackles, nine sacks, five fumble recoveries and two interceptions. Smith signed a six-year, $68 million contract extension with the team in 2019.

Injury:

Jaylon Smith’s life – and finances – changed forever. A star linebacker at Notre Dame and a sure-fire first-round draft pick, Smith suffered a devastating knee injury in the Fiesta Bowl against Ohio State. The torn ACL was bad.

Salary:

Smith signed a $64 million, five-year extension before the 2019 season. About $34 million of that contract was guaranteed.
